vfp程序设计实验报告簿.doc

上传人:marr****208 文档编号:117181518 上传时间:2019-11-18 格式:DOC 页数:50 大小:1.07MB
返回 下载 相关 举报
vfp程序设计实验报告簿.doc_第1页
第1页 / 共50页
vfp程序设计实验报告簿.doc_第2页
第2页 / 共50页
vfp程序设计实验报告簿.doc_第3页
第3页 / 共50页
vfp程序设计实验报告簿.doc_第4页
第4页 / 共50页
vfp程序设计实验报告簿.doc_第5页
第5页 / 共50页
点击查看更多>>
资源描述

《vfp程序设计实验报告簿.doc》由会员分享,可在线阅读,更多相关《vfp程序设计实验报告簿.doc(50页珍藏版)》请在金锄头文库上搜索。

1、VFP程序设计课程实验报告簿专业班级_学 号_姓 名_指导教师_盐城工学院实验教学部二一二年一月实 验 报 告实验日期_实验一 VFP集成开发环境【实验目的与要求】1.掌握Visual FoxPro6.0(以下简称VFP6.0)的启动与退出。2.熟悉VFP6.0的集成开发环境。3.熟悉VFP6.0的项目管理器及辅助设计工具的使用。4.掌握VFP6.0各种文件的建立与保存。【实验内容与步骤】实验素材文件夹为C:VFPSy01,实验开始时,先启动VFP(如果已启动VFP,请选退出VFP),然后在命令窗口(如果没有出现命令窗口,单击“窗口”菜单中的“命令窗口”命令即可打开命令窗口)中输入:set d

2、efault to C:VFPSy01,然后按回车键,设置该文件夹为默认路径。实验1.1.11.根据图1.1.1给出的VFP集成开发环境,写出AF分别代表的VFP主界面组成部分的名称,并填在下面的表格中。序号ABCDEF名称命令窗口工具栏标题栏工作区窗口状态栏菜单栏2.根据图1.1.1给出的VFP集成开发环境,分别新建一个“项目”、“数据库”、“表”、“查询”、“表单”、“报表”、“程序”、“菜单”,保存这些文件(保存路径为C:VFPSy01,文件名为默认文件名),观察这些类型文件包含的所有文件的文件名(包括扩展名)并填在下面的表格中。观察在命令窗口显示的命令,熟悉每条命令并填在下面的表格中。

3、类别文件名(包含扩展名)命令窗口中的命令项目项目1.pjx项目1.PJTCREATE PROJECT数据库数据1.dbc数据1.dct 数据1.dcxCREATE DATABASE表表1.dbfCREATE 表1.dbf查询查询1.qprCREATE QUERY表单表单1.scx表单1.sctCREATE FORM报表报表1.frx报表1.FRTCREATE REPORT程序程序1.prgMODIFY COMMAND菜单菜单1.mnx菜单1.MNTCREATE MENU3.打开上题中保存的项目,在项目管理器中将上题中保存的“数据库”、“查询”、“表单”、“报表”、“程序”、“菜单”添加到项目中

4、,“表”添加到数据库中。答:操作步骤如下:1.单击“文件”-“打开” 选择“项目1.pjx”打开项目管理器。实 验 报 告2“数据”选项卡 选择“数据库” 单击“添加”添加“数据1.dbc”3按照如上步骤,依次将“查询”、“表单”、“报表”、“程序”、“菜单”添加到项目中,“表”添加到数据库中。CFBEAD图1.1.1实验1.1.21.利用“表向导”创建表。单击“文件”菜单中的“新建”命令,打开“新建”对话框,在“文件类型”中选择“表”,再单击“向导”,打开“表向导”对话框,在“步骤1-字段选取”中,样表选择“Students”,将可用字段StudentId、FirstName、City、Ma

5、jor添加到选定字段中,单击“完成”按钮,在“步骤4-完成”中再单击“完成”按钮,打开“另存为”对话框,表名就用默认文件名“students.dbf”,最后单击“保存”按钮。2.利用“表设计器”查看表。单击“文件”菜单中的“打开”命令或单击“打开”工具栏,打开“打开”对话框,文件类型中选择“表(*.dbf)”,文件列表框中选择“students.dbf”,单击“确定”按钮;再单击“显示”菜单中的“表设计器”命令,打开“表设计器”对话框,查看该表有哪些字段,每个字段的类型及宽度并填在下面的表格中。字段名类型宽度studentid 字符型 15firstname 字符型 15city 字符型 30

6、major 字符型 203.利用“表设计器”建立索引。选择“表设计器”对话框中的“索引”选项,在“索引名”中输入sid,“排序”中选择“降序”,“类型”中选择“唯一索引”,索引表达式为字段“studentid”,单击“确定”按钮,在打开的对话框中选择“是”,保存退出表设计器,将索引的相关文件名(包括扩展名)填在下面的表格中。索引文件名扩展名studentsCDX4.添加记录。单击“显示”菜单中的“浏览”命令,再单击“显示”菜单中的“追加方实 验 报 告式”命令,输入如图1.1.2所示的七条记录并保存。图1.1.2实验1.1.31.利用“查询向导”创建查询。单击“文件”菜单中的“新建”命令,打开

7、“新建”对话框,在“文件类型”中选择“查询”,再单击“向导”,打开“向导选取”对话框,选择“查询向导”,单击“确定”按钮,打开“查询向导”对话框,在“步骤1-字段选取”中,“数据库和表”选择实验1.1.2中的表students,可用字段全部添加到选定字段中,单击“完成”按钮,在“步骤5-完成”中再单击“完成”按钮,打开“另存为”对话框,文件名中输入“querystu.qpr”,单击“保存”按钮。2.查询设计器的使用。单击“文件”菜单中的“打开”命令或单击“打开”工具栏,打开“打开”对话框,文件类型中选择“查询(*.qpr)”,文件列表框中选择“querystu.qpr”,单击“确定”按钮,打开

8、“查询设计器”窗口,选择“筛选”选项,在“字段名”中选择“Students.major”,“条件”中选择“=”,“实例”中输入材料,单击“查询”菜单中的“运行查询”命令或按组合键Crtl+Q或单击工具栏上的“运行”按钮或按组合键Crtl+E,出现如图1.1.3所示界面,写出对应的SQL语句(单击“查询”菜单中的“查看SQL”命令)。答:SQL语句是SELECT *; FROM students; WHERE Students.major = 材料图1.1.33.打开查询设计器,在表Students.dbf中筛选出所在城市为“盐城”的所有学生,运行后如图1.1.4所示,写出对应的SQL语句。答:

9、SQL语句是SELECT *; FROM students; WHERE Students.city = 盐城实 验 报 告图1.1.44.打开查询设计器,在表Students.dbf中筛选出所在城市为“南京”,专业是“工商”的所有学生,运行后如图1.1.5所示,写出对应的SQL语句。答:SQL语句是SELECT *; FROM students; WHERE Students.city = 南京 and Students.major = 工商图1.1.55.打开查询设计器,在表Students.dbf中筛选姓陈的所有学生,运行后如图1.1.6所示,写出对应的SQL语句。答:SQL语句是SEL

10、ECT *; FROM students; WHERE Students.firstname LIKE 陈%图1.1.6成 绩_批改日期_实 验 报 告实验日期_实验二 VFP的数据类型与数据运算 【实验目的与要求】1.掌握VFP6.0常量及输出格式。2.掌握VFP6.0简单内存变量和数组。3.掌握VVFP6.0表达式及运算。4.掌握VFP6.0常用函数。【实验内容与步骤】实验素材文件夹为C:VFPSy02,实验开始时,在命令窗口中输入 set default to C:VFPSy02,然后按回车键。实验1.2.1 简单内存变量1.在命令窗口中利用命令?和?分别输出数值型常量65.123、-7

11、8.9,1.5107,观察工作区窗口的输出形式,总结?与?的区别,填在下面的表格中。命令输出区别?换行?不换行2.在工作区窗口输出“学生爱好VFP”,写出应在命令窗口输入的命令,并填在下面的表格中。输出结果命令学生爱好VFP?学生爱好VFP3.在工作区窗口输出日期“10/12/05”,若要使该日期代表2005年10月12日,写出应在命令窗口输入的命令,并填在下面的表格中。若要使该日期代表2010年12月5日,写出应在命令窗口输入的命令,并填在下面的表格中。输出日期命令2005年10月12日set date to mdy ?2005-10-122010年12月05日set date to ymd

12、 ?2010-12-54.在工作区窗口中输出货币型数据1.23,写出应在命令窗口输入的命令并写出工作区输出的数据形式,填在下面的表格中。输出的数据形式命令?$1.231.2300实验1.2.2 数组变量1.将数值6.0分别赋给内存变量a1、b1,字符串Visual FoxPro同时赋给内存变量a2、b2,在工作区窗口仅显示包含字符a的内存变量a1、a2的信息,仔细观察工作区窗口输出实 验 报 告的信息,并将该信息保存到C:VFPSy02memoryinf.txt中。写出要达到上述要求应在命令窗口中输入的命令,填在下面的表格中。项目命令数值6.0赋给内存变量a1a1=6.0数值6.0赋给内存变量

13、b1b1=6.0字符串Visual FoxPro同时赋给内存变量a2、b2store Visual FoxPro to a2,b2显示包含字符a的内存变量a1、a2的信息List memory like a? a1、a2的信息保存到C:VFPSy02memoryinf.txt中List memory like a? to file memoryinf.txt2.定义一个一维数组C,能存放3个元素,第一个数组元素存入的是数值6.0,第二个数组元素存入的是字符串Visual FoxPro,第三个数组元素不赋值,并将数组C的所有元素在工作区窗口中输出,仔细观察工作区窗口输出的信息,写出在命令窗口输入

14、的命令并填在下面的表格中。项目命令定义一个一维数组C,能存放3个元素dimension c(3)数值6.0赋给第一个数组元素c(1)=6.0字符串Visual FoxPro赋给第二个数组元素c(2)=Visual FoxPro显示数组C的所有元素?c(1),c(2),c(3)实验1.2.3 表达式1.在命令窗口中依次输入x=2、y=3、?(x+2)*y%6x,将变量或表达式的值填在下面的表格中。变量或表达式变量或表达式的值x2y3(x+2)*y%6x-22.在命令窗口中依次输入a=江苏 (注意:字符串江苏后面有一个空格)、b=盐城、c=工学院、?a+b+c,a-b-c,将变量或表达式的值填在下面的表格中。变量或表达式变量或表达式的值a江苏b盐城c工学院a+b+c江苏 盐城 工学院 a

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 大杂烩/其它

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号